Definitions:

Direct Labor Hours

The total number of work hours spent by employees who directly manufacture or produce goods.

Predetermined Overhead Rate

An estimate used to allocate overhead costs to products or job orders, calculated before the costs are incurred.

Finished Goods

Items that are finished with the production phase but are still awaiting sale or delivery to consumers.

Cost of Goods Sold

The direct costs attributable to the production of goods sold by a company, including materials and labor costs.
